+//===-- NativeRegisterContextLinux_x86_64.h ---------------------*- C++ -*-===//
+//
+// The LLVM Compiler Infrastructure
+//
+// This file is distributed under the University of Illinois Open Source
+// License. See LICENSE.TXT for details.
+//
+//===----------------------------------------------------------------------===//
+
+#if defined(__i386__) || defined(__x86_64__)
+
+#ifndef lldb_NativeRegisterContextLinux_x86_64_h
+#define lldb_NativeRegisterContextLinux_x86_64_h
+
+#include "Plugins/Process/Linux/NativeRegisterContextLinux.h"
+#include "Plugins/Process/Utility/RegisterContext_x86.h"
+#include "Plugins/Process/Utility/lldb-x86-register-enums.h"
+
+namespace lldb_private {
+namespace process_linux {
+
+ class NativeProcessLinux;
+
+ class NativeRegisterContextLinux_x86_64 : public NativeRegisterContextLinux
+ {
+ public:
+ NativeRegisterContextLinux_x86_64 (const ArchSpec& target_arch,
+ NativeThreadProtocol &native_thread,
+ uint32_t concrete_frame_idx);
+
+ uint32_t
+ GetRegisterSetCount () const override;
+
+ const RegisterSet *
+ GetRegisterSet (uint32_t set_index) const override;
+
+ uint32_t
+ GetUserRegisterCount() const override;
+
+ Error
+ ReadRegister (const RegisterInfo *reg_info, RegisterValue &reg_value) override;
+
+ Error
+ WriteRegister (const RegisterInfo *reg_info, const RegisterValue &reg_value) override;
+
+ Error
+ ReadAllRegisterValues (lldb::DataBufferSP &data_sp) override;
+
+ Error
+ WriteAllRegisterValues (const lldb::DataBufferSP &data_sp) override;
+
+ Error
+ IsWatchpointHit(uint32_t wp_index, bool &is_hit) override;
+
+ Error
+ GetWatchpointHitIndex(uint32_t &wp_index, lldb::addr_t trap_addr) override;
+
+ Error
+ IsWatchpointVacant(uint32_t wp_index, bool &is_vacant) override;
+
+ bool
+ ClearHardwareWatchpoint(uint32_t wp_index) override;
+
+ Error
+ ClearAllHardwareWatchpoints () override;
+
+ Error
+ SetHardwareWatchpointWithIndex(lldb::addr_t addr, size_t size,
+ uint32_t watch_flags, uint32_t wp_index);
+
+ uint32_t
+ SetHardwareWatchpoint(lldb::addr_t addr, size_t size,
+ uint32_t watch_flags) override;
+
+ lldb::addr_t
+ GetWatchpointAddress(uint32_t wp_index) override;
+
+ uint32_t
+ NumSupportedHardwareWatchpoints() override;
+
+ protected:
+ void*
+ GetGPRBuffer() override { return &m_gpr_x86_64; }
+
+ void*
+ GetFPRBuffer() override;
+
+ size_t
+ GetFPRSize() override;
+
+ Error
+ ReadFPR() override;
+
+ Error
+ WriteFPR() override;
+
+ private:
+
+ // Private member types.
+ enum FPRType
+ {
+ eFPRTypeNotValid = 0,
+ eFPRTypeFXSAVE,
+ eFPRTypeXSAVE
+ };
+
+ // Info about register ranges.
+ struct RegInfo
+ {
+ uint32_t num_registers;
+ uint32_t num_gpr_registers;
+ uint32_t num_fpr_registers;
+ uint32_t num_avx_registers;
+
+ uint32_t last_gpr;
+ uint32_t first_fpr;
+ uint32_t last_fpr;
+
+ uint32_t first_st;
+ uint32_t last_st;
+ uint32_t first_mm;
+ uint32_t last_mm;
+ uint32_t first_xmm;
+ uint32_t last_xmm;
+ uint32_t first_ymm;
+ uint32_t last_ymm;
+
+ uint32_t first_dr;
+ uint32_t gpr_flags;
+ };
+
+ // Private member variables.
+ mutable FPRType m_fpr_type;
+ FPR m_fpr;
+ IOVEC m_iovec;
+ YMM m_ymm_set;
+ RegInfo m_reg_info;
+ uint64_t m_gpr_x86_64[k_num_gpr_registers_x86_64];
+ uint32_t m_fctrl_offset_in_userarea;
+
+ // Private member methods.
+ bool IsRegisterSetAvailable (uint32_t set_index) const;
+
+ bool
+ IsGPR(uint32_t reg_index) const;
+
+ FPRType
+ GetFPRType () const;
+
+ bool
+ IsFPR(uint32_t reg_index) const;
+
+ bool
+ IsFPR(uint32_t reg_index, FPRType fpr_type) const;
+
+ bool
+ CopyXSTATEtoYMM (uint32_t reg_index, lldb::ByteOrder byte_order);
+
+ bool
+ CopyYMMtoXSTATE(uint32_t reg, lldb::ByteOrder byte_order);
+
+ bool
+ IsAVX (uint32_t reg_index) const;
+ };
+
+} // namespace process_linux
+} // namespace lldb_private
+
+#endif // #ifndef lldb_NativeRegisterContextLinux_x86_64_h
+
+#endif // defined(__i386__) || defined(__x86_64__)
